首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

box.info.vclock中的旧实例

是指Tarantool数据库中的一个元数据字段,用于记录数据对象的版本信息。在Tarantool中,每个数据对象都有一个唯一的版本号,称为vclock(vector clock)。vclock是一个由多个节点的逻辑时钟组成的向量,用于表示数据对象在不同节点上的版本。

旧实例是指在进行数据更新操作时,Tarantool会将旧版本的数据对象保留在内存中,直到所有相关的事务都完成。这样做的目的是为了支持并发事务处理和MVCC(多版本并发控制)机制。通过保留旧实例,Tarantool可以在事务处理过程中提供一致性和隔离性。

旧实例在Tarantool中的存储方式是通过box.info.vclock字段来记录。box.info.vclock是一个元数据表,用于存储每个数据对象的版本信息。它包含了每个节点的逻辑时钟值,以及对应的数据对象版本号。通过比较不同节点上的逻辑时钟值,Tarantool可以判断数据对象的版本是否过期,从而实现并发控制和冲突解决。

旧实例的应用场景包括分布式事务处理、数据一致性保证和冲突解决等。在分布式系统中,多个节点可能同时对同一个数据对象进行更新操作,通过使用旧实例和vclock,Tarantool可以实现数据的一致性和并发控制,避免数据冲突和数据丢失的问题。

对于Tarantool数据库,腾讯云提供了相应的产品和服务支持。腾讯云的数据库产品包括TencentDB for Tarantool,它是一种高性能、高可用的分布式数据库服务,基于Tarantool开发。TencentDB for Tarantool提供了自动扩展、数据备份、数据恢复等功能,可以满足各种应用场景的需求。

更多关于TencentDB for Tarantool的信息和产品介绍,可以访问腾讯云官方网站的相关页面:TencentDB for Tarantool

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券